Transponder keys equipped with an electronic chip are required for cars equipped with immobiliser systems. If your transponder keys are prior to 1995, there’s no need to program it. A locksmith can cut and program a duplicate key for you in minutes. They may require access to the vehicle to read the wireless data. You can also get your keys replaced at your local auto repair shop.

Transponder keys differ from normal car keys. For instance, laser-cut keys include a chip. Typically, they have to be programmed into the car with a transponder chip. In certain instances the transponder chip will need to be programmed prior to the time that the car can start. Although most dealerships offer this service at no cost they may charge an amount to program the transponder key. You can also find the machines to program at most auto locksmiths. Key makers will charge $150 to $300 to replace a laser cut key.

A specific machine is required to cut keys using lasers. This machine is more expensive. Car dealerships and locksmiths that specialize in these services will be able program these keys properly but you’ll need spend a little more money to acquire one. The keys are more secure, and requires special equipment. Furthermore, the majority of people assume they’ll have to go to an establishment if they lose their key.

The cost of replacing a lock cylinder can vary from $50 to $250. Based on the type of lock cylinder as well as the model of your car the cost of this component can range between $10 and thebon.co.kr hundreds of dollars. A reconditioned lock cylinder can be purchased for the 2008 Toyota Camry LE for $39-177. A lock cylinder for the 2008 Ford Focus SE is also available for purchase at $99 or $119.

The locks on cars can be damaged due to a variety of accidents. In the event of an accident for instance the door lock can be broken. In such cases, the replacement of doors typically involves rekeying the ignition, to match the new locks. Other scenarios can result in damaged ignitions or damaged doors, such as vandalism or auto theft. This means that you should have a spare set keys in case of when keys to your car go missing.

You can employ locksmiths to rekey your car locks if worried about security. Rekeying your car isn’t as difficult as you might think. The procedure requires replacing the wafers or pins of the ignition lock. Once the car has been rekeyed, you need to create a new set of keys.
